When brake pedal is applied, brakelight switch sends a signal to ECM. If torque converter clutch is in lock-up mode, ECM cancels lock-up operation and prevents engine stall when coming to a stop. DTC will set if ECM detects brakelight switch signal does not turn off during driving. Possible causes are:
- Open or short in brakelight switch circuit.
- Brakelight switch malfunction.
- ECM malfunction.
